]> git.pld-linux.org Git - packages/CGAL.git/blob - CGAL-build-library.patch
24cf2f297bf5bce2e534b125ef34b90de550a678
[packages/CGAL.git] / CGAL-build-library.patch
1 --- CGAL-3.3/install_cgal.build-library.bak     2007-05-30 14:05:18.000000000 +0200
2 +++ CGAL-3.3/install_cgal       2007-05-30 14:14:10.000000000 +0200
3 @@ -937,7 +937,6 @@
4             #### settings for sgi mipspro compiler on irix5
5             CGAL_SHARED_LIB_CXXFLAGS=
6             CGAL_SHARED_LIB_LDFLAGS="-lm"
7 -           RUNTIME_LINKER_FLAG="-rpath "
8             PRINT_STACKTRACE_PROGRAM="dbx"
9             ;;
10         *IRIX*6.*CC*7.3*)
11 @@ -946,14 +945,12 @@
12             ADDITIONAL_LDFLAGS="-LANG:std"
13             CGAL_STATIC_LIB_CREATE="\$(CGAL_CXX) -ar -o''"
14             CGAL_SHARED_LIB_CXXFLAGS=
15 -           RUNTIME_LINKER_FLAG="-rpath "
16             PRINT_STACKTRACE_PROGRAM="dbx"
17             ;;
18         *IRIX*6.*CC*)
19             #### settings for sgi mipspro compiler on irix6
20             CGAL_STATIC_LIB_CREATE="\$(CGAL_CXX) -ar -o''"
21             CGAL_SHARED_LIB_CXXFLAGS=
22 -           RUNTIME_LINKER_FLAG="-rpath "
23             PRINT_STACKTRACE_PROGRAM="dbx"
24             ;;
25         *IRIX*g++*)
26 @@ -961,7 +958,6 @@
27             ADDITIONAL_CXXFLAGS="-Wall"
28             LONG_NAME_PROBLEM_LDFLAGS="-U -s"
29             CGAL_SHARED_LIB_LDFLAGS="-lm"
30 -           RUNTIME_LINKER_FLAG="-Xlinker -rpath -Xlinker "
31             CGAL_SHARED_LIB_SONAME="-Wl,-soname,\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
32             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
33             CGAL_SHARED_LIBNAME_WITH_SOMAJOR="\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
34 @@ -973,7 +969,6 @@
35             CGAL_STATIC_LIB_CREATE="\$(CGAL_CXX) -xar -o ''"
36             CGAL_SHARED_LIB_CXXFLAGS="-PIC"
37             CGAL_SHARED_LIB_CREATE="\$(CGAL_CXX) -G"
38 -           RUNTIME_LINKER_FLAG="-R "
39             PRINT_STACKTRACE_PROGRAM="dbx"
40             CGAL_SHARED_LIB_SONAME="-Qoption ld -h\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
41             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
42 @@ -986,7 +981,6 @@
43             LONG_NAME_PROBLEM_CXXFLAGS="-g"
44             LONG_NAME_PROBLEM_LDFLAGS="-z nodefs -s"
45             CGAL_SHARED_LIB_CREATE="\$(CGAL_CXX) -G"
46 -           RUNTIME_LINKER_FLAG="-R "
47             CGAL_SHARED_LIB_SONAME="-h \$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
48             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
49             CGAL_SHARED_LIBNAME_WITH_SOMAJOR="\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
50 @@ -995,7 +989,6 @@
51             #### settings for g++ on alpha-linux (special FPU handling)
52             #### LONG_NAME_PROBLEM is cured by disabling debugging
53             ADDITIONAL_CXXFLAGS="-Wall -mieee -mfp-rounding-mode=d"
54 -           RUNTIME_LINKER_FLAG='-Wl,-R'
55             CGAL_SHARED_LIB_SONAME="-Wl,-soname,\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
56             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
57             CGAL_SHARED_LIBNAME_WITH_SOMAJOR="\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
58 @@ -1003,7 +996,6 @@
59         *Linux*g++*)
60             #### settings for g++ on linux
61             ADDITIONAL_CXXFLAGS="-Wall"
62 -           RUNTIME_LINKER_FLAG='-Wl,-R'
63             CGAL_SHARED_LIB_SONAME="-Wl,-soname,\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
64             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
65             CGAL_SHARED_LIBNAME_WITH_SOMAJOR="\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
66 @@ -1013,12 +1005,10 @@
67             # -mp is required for correct enough floating point operations
68             # necessary for interval arithmetic.
69             ADDITIONAL_CXXFLAGS="-mp"
70 -           RUNTIME_LINKER_FLAG='-Wl,-R'
71             PRINT_STACKTRACE_PROGRAM="idb"
72             ;;
73         *Linux*pgCC*|*Linux*pgcpp*)
74             #### settings for Portland Group Compiler on linux
75 -           RUNTIME_LINKER_FLAG='-Wl,-R'
76             # PGCC has long name problems with "-g".
77             DEBUG_OPT=""
78             ;;
79 @@ -1029,7 +1019,6 @@
80             CGAL_STATIC_LIB_CREATE="\$(CGAL_CXX) -xar -o ''"
81             CGAL_SHARED_LIB_CXXFLAGS="-PIC"
82             CGAL_SHARED_LIB_CREATE="\$(CGAL_CXX) -G"
83 -           RUNTIME_LINKER_FLAG="-R "
84             PRINT_STACKTRACE_PROGRAM="dbx"
85             CGAL_SHARED_LIB_SONAME="-Qoption ld -h\$(CGAL_SHARED_LIBNAME).\$(SOMAJOR)"
86             CGAL_SHARED_LIBNAME_WITH_SOVERSION="\$(CGAL_SHARED_LIBNAME).\$(SOVERSION)"
87 @@ -4335,7 +4319,7 @@
88      _buildlog_marker="log for $1 $2 shown"
89  
90      ${_printf} "%s %s\n" "${MAKE}" "${MAKE_OPTION}" > "${COMPILE_LOGFILE}"
91 -    if ${MAKE} ${MAKE_OPTION} >"${COMPILE_LOGFILE}" 2>&1; then
92 +    if ${MAKE} ${MAKE_OPTION} | tee "${COMPILE_LOGFILE}" 2>&1; then
93         log_print "Compilation of $1 $2 ${_libname} succeeded."
94         log_print "vvvvvvvvvvvv build ${_buildlog_marker} below vvvvvvvvvvvv"
95         eval ${_cat} \"${COMPILE_LOGFILE}\" ${INSTALL_LOGFILE_REDIRECTION}
This page took 0.041149 seconds and 2 git commands to generate.